Notable Milestones in Malaysia Used Car Market Sector
- March 2023: Mitsubishi Malaysia introduced its pre-owned car initiative, the Max Certified program, featuring a thorough 150-point inspection by certified specialists, a 12-month warranty covering essential components, and a MYR 500 service e-voucher for buyers.
- February 2022: Honda Malaysia’s Certified Used Car (HCUC) program continued its operation, offering certified pre-owned Honda vehicles equipped with genuine parts and guaranteed to be free from major accidents, ensuring quality assurance and reliability.
